Lyrix features and specs

  • Comprehensive Lyrics Database
    Lyrix provides access to a wide and diverse collection of song lyrics, enabling users to find the words to nearly any song across various genres and artists.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The platform is designed with an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, making it simple for users to search for and view lyrics.
  • Real-Time Updates
    Lyrix continuously updates its database with the latest song releases, ensuring that users have access to the most current lyrics available.
  • Mobile Access
    Lyrix offers a mobile-friendly version or app, allowing users to access the platform on-the-go from their smartphones or tablets.

Possible disadvantages of Lyrix

  • Subscription Fees
    Access to certain features or full content on Lyrix might require a subscription, which could be a downside for users looking for free alternatives.
  • Limited Offline Access
    Users may need an internet connection to access the full range of features, limiting accessibility in offline scenarios.
  • Potential Licensing Issues
    Like any lyrics platform, Lyrix might face challenges with lyrics licensing rights, affecting the availability of certain lyrics.
  • Ads and Pop-Ups
    Free versions of the platform may contain advertisements or pop-ups that could detract from the user experience.

DevLogs features and specs

  • Community Engagement
    DevLogs offers a platform for developers to engage with a community, where they can receive feedback and support on their projects.
  • Documentation
    By maintaining DevLogs, developers can create a comprehensive record of their development process, which can be useful for future reference and learning.
  • Accountability
    Regularly updating a DevLog can help developers stay accountable to their goals and timelines, encouraging consistent progress.
  • Skill Improvement
    Writing about their work can help developers communicate their ideas more clearly, aiding personal skill improvement in technical writing and storytelling.

Possible disadvantages of DevLogs

  • Time-Consuming
    Maintaining a DevLog requires a significant time investment, which can detract from the time available for actual development work.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Developers may have to be cautious about what they share publicly, as sensitive information or project details could be inadvertently disclosed.
  • Pressure to Entertain
    Developers might feel pressured to create engaging content for their audience, potentially shifting focus from genuine progress to content creation.
  • Overcomplexity
    Some developers might find DevLogs to be overly complex or difficult to maintain, especially if they prefer simple documentation methods.
